Embodiment 1

[0038] 1. Biological enzyme source: the enzyme-producing strain is Aspergillus niger with the preservation number CGMCC0571.

[0039] 2. Activation and cultivation of Aspergillus niger:

[0040] Aspergillus niger strains were activated and cultivated in potato sucrose medium, then inserted into sterilized seed medium, and incubated at 28°C, 250r min -1 Cultivate on a shaking table for 24 hours; insert the seed liquid into a sterilized 500ml shake flask (containing 100ml of enzyme-producing culture solution) according to 10% inoculation amount, and carry out enzyme-producing culture at 25°C for 96 hours to obtain a fermentation broth.

[0041] Among them: main components of seed medium (g L -1 ): Glucose 50, KCl 0.2, KH 2 PO 4 0.15, MgSO 4 ·7H 2 O0.12, (NH 4 ) 2 HPO 4 0.6, yeast extract 3, peptone 2. Abstract

The invention provides a method for improving the quality of expanded cut rolled stem of tobacco by microbial enzyme. The procedures are as follows:1) Preparation of bio-enzyme: (1) Aspergillus niger is activated and cultured by potato cane sugar culture medium and is then transferred into sterilized seed culture medium, and shake cultivation is carried out at the temperature of 28 DEG C for 24 hours with 250r/min<-1>; seed liquid with 10% of inoculation amount is transferred into a sterilized 500ml shake flask (containing 100ml culture liquid for enzyme), and the seed liquid carries out incubation for culturing at the temperature of 25 DEG C for 96 hours and then zymotic liquid is obtained. (2) Extraction of lignin degradation complex enzyme: After being filtered by filter paper, the zymotic liquid is centrifugally separated at the low speed of 1500rpm. The supernatant carries out fractional salting out by (NH4)2SO4 till the saturation is 0.7 to obtain crude enzyme liquid, after the crude enzyme liquid carries out ultrafiltration dialysis, the lignin degradation complex enzyme is obtained. Activities of enzyme components: 350U/L of Lip, 11U/L of MnP and 5.6U/L of Lac; 2) Improvement of the quality of expanded cut rolled stem of tobacco: The expanded cut rolled stem for cigarette is weighed and sprayed evenly by lignin degradation complex enzyme liquid containing 0.2-0.4% of expanded cut rolled stem after being diluted by distilled water at the temperature of 27 DEG C-29 DEG C. The expanded cut rolled stem of tobacco is placed in a sealed container for enzymolysis for 95-97 hours and dried naturally till the moisture content is 12.5%-15%. The result by subjective analysis suggests that the complex enzyme preparation can effectively decrease the lignin content of the expanded cut rolled stem, promote the transformation of aroma matter and improve aroma quality and taste.

technical field [0001] The invention relates to the technical field of cut tobacco stem treatment, in particular to a method for improving the quality of expanded cut stems of tobacco leaves by using microbial enzymes. Background technique [0002] With the development of cigarette production technology, adding shredded stems to the main raw material shredded tobacco can significantly improve the single weight, draw resistance, mainstream smoke and sensory quality of cigarettes, and the specific performance is that the single cigarette weight and draw resistance are on a downward trend; The purpose of reducing the total particulate matter, tar and CO in mainstream smoke of cigarettes can be achieved. Therefore, adding a certain amount of shredded stems to cigarette raw materials has become one of the key technical links generally adopted by domestic and foreign cigarette manufacturers in order to further improve the quality of cigarettes and reduce tar and harm.
